Cam On Spa in Hue, what happens before the massage
The meeting point is Cam On Spa at 37 Chu Văn An, Phú Hội, Huế 53000. It runs daily from 9:00 AM to 11:00 PM, and the activity ends back where you start. It is set up as a mobile ticket experience, so you can focus on showing up rather than printing anything.
When you arrive, the mood is meant to feel easy right away. One of the nicer touches is that you are given courtesy flip flops at the start, so you can move around comfortably without thinking about what footwear to wear inside. The staff are also described as warm and patient, which matters if you want help deciding among massage options.
You will spend a bit of time getting settled, then the therapist takes over. The session itself is designed around a full body treatment, not just one area like shoulders or back. The goal is to loosen tight spots and reduce general tension, which is exactly what you want after hours walking around Hue.
Cam On Spa uses a straightforward approach, and the menus are available in English. That is a practical win, especially if you are unsure what style or pressure level to choose. You also have a decent window to pick the time of day, which helps you match the massage to your itinerary.

Price in Hue: why $8 can make sense

The price listed is $8 for a 75 minute experience, which is a strong value if the session is delivered with care. In places like Hue, where costs can be lower than big-city prices, this kind of treatment can be a bargain if you want something practical, relaxing, and not overly complicated.
Still, I suggest you budget responsibly. One note from feedback is that a 7% sales tax may not be included in the base price. That does not mean the experience is overpriced, but it does mean your final total might be slightly higher than the sticker.
Even with tax in mind, the value is still usually excellent for what you get: full body work, professional attention, and a finishing tea moment with treats. You are paying for time with a therapist, a quiet environment, and a structured session length. If you were to pay more elsewhere for a similar time slot, you might get less added comfort.
What also boosts value is the staff approach. People describe the hospitality as welcoming and thoughtful, with extra details like the flip flops, an English menu, and patient guidance. Those small things are not just niceties, they reduce confusion and help you enjoy the experience more.
Timing and logistics: fitting this into your Hue day

You can choose a morning, afternoon, or evening appointment. That flexibility is useful because Hue sightseeing can be unpredictable. Weather shifts, heat, or even a late start can happen, so having a time choice lets you pick when your body will feel most ready to relax.
The spa is open from 9:00 AM to 11:00 PM. That is late enough that you could schedule it after a day of walking, but early enough that you can still plan dinner and an evening stroll without feeling like you are stuck.
You are also close to public transportation, which helps if you are not staying right in the middle of everything. The exact nearest stop is not specified, but the fact that it is near transit means you should be able to get there without stress.
Group size is capped at a maximum of 25 travelers. That does not mean you will always feel like a group is everywhere, but it suggests a manageable flow rather than a giant crowd. For a massage, a quieter setting is part of the value, and smaller caps usually help keep the vibe calmer.
If you want the best experience, time it so you are not rushing. Plan a little buffer before your appointment if you are coming from a busy market or a long walk. You want to arrive with your mind settled, not still thinking about tickets or traffic.

FAQ
How long is the Hue Traditional Full Body Massage experience?
It is listed as 75 minutes, approximately 1 hour 10 minutes.
What does the massage cost?
The price is $8.
Where does the experience start?
It starts at Cam On Spa, 37 Chu Văn An, Phú Hội, Huế 53000, Vietnam.
What happens after the massage?
You can relax after your massage with included tea, and you are also set up to enjoy complimentary local tea and delicacies.
Do I get to choose a time of day?
Yes. You can pick a morning, afternoon, or evening appointment.
Is there a group size limit?
Yes. The maximum group size is 25 travelers.
What is the cancellation policy?
Free cancellation is available up to 24 hours before the experience starts for a full refund. If you cancel less than 24 hours before, you will not get a refund.
